General and overall provision after studying latest act , previous act and incoming act is

1) You need to apply in District Court for inquisition about mental health of mentally retarded person , it will be done by Doctors appointed by Court or their panel

2) After they give report then you need to appoint guardian from Dist. Court

3) Above two procedure will take around 3-4 months min.

4) Then under new law The Right of person with disabilities Act 2016 sec 14 guardian or relative will be required to apply for appointment of a limited guardian to take legally binding decision on behalf of mentally retarted person.

Decision which limited guardian should take will require approval of Hon. District Court and funds transfer regarding mentally retarted person in specific account etc as directed by Hon. District Court.

5) Above point 2 and 4 are clashing or overlapping this thing is because of two law , one law which is yet to come in force and will commence when infrastructure is ready in 2-3 months and old act which is going to get repelled in 2-3 months .

6) So there can be some variation or further rules change in this transit period till May 2017

---------------------------------------

To reduce expenses there is provision under the new law THE RIGHTS OF PERSONS WITH DISABILITIES ACT, 2016 that District legal cell has to help person legally with disability and in your case that is (mentally retarded person) free of cost.

You approach dist legal cell It will be present in District Court of your District

tell them that you want first 1) Official appointment of guardian for mentally retarted person or 2) If natural gaurdian like father mother are alive then appointment of limited guardian to take legally binding decision on behalf of mentally retarded person as per new act that is THE RIGHTS OF PERSONS WITH DISABILITIES ACT, 2016
